An Order Suppressed by Frederick W. Hamilton is the story of the Knights Templar and their suppression at the hands of Pope clement V and the French king Philip Le Bel in the years between 1307 and 1312. Starting with a brief account of the origins and rise of the Order, the author quickly moves to the Templars' arrest and torture ending with the execution of the last Grand Master of the Order - Jacques De Molay.
